




已阅读5页,还剩2页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
常 州 轻 工 职 业 技 术 学 院 可视化程序设计 课 程 授 课 教 案 No 28 授 课 日 期2012/4/17授 课 班 级课 题实验七:基本数据访问窗体设计授 课 类 型实验课课 时 数2教 学目 的掌握通过窗体向数据库中输入信息的方法重 点难 点向数据库中输入信息教 具挂 图教学过程及时间分配主 要 教 学 内 容教学方法的运用10分5分75分实验内容:向数据库XSGL的学生信息表追加记录,用户在功能窗体上输入学生的基本信息,单击“保存”按钮将各数据项组成一条记录插入到学生信息表中。一、 界面设计:二、 设置窗体和控件的属性三、 数据录入窗体的程序代码讲解指导练习40分private void Form1_Load(object sender, System.EventArgs e)/初始化comboBoxClass(班级)string connectionString=Server=.;Database=XSGL;user id=sa; pwd=;SqlConnection myConnection=new SqlConnection(connectionString);SqlCommand myCommand=myConnection.CreateCommand();myCommand.CommandText=select * from 班级信息表;myConnection.Open();SqlDataReader my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xClass.Items.Add(myDataReader班级名称);myDataReader.Close();comboBoxClass.SelectedIndex=0;/初始化日期拾取器DateTime now=DateTime.Now;int year=now.Year-19;DateTime dt=new DateTime(year,now.Month,now.Day); dateTimePicker1.Value=dt;/初始化comboBoxFace(政治面貌)myCommand.CommandText=select * from 政治面貌代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xFace.Items.Add(myDataReader政治面貌);myDataReader.Close();comboBoxFace.SelectedIndex=0;/初始化comboBoxNation(民族)指导练习1510分10分myCommand.CommandText=select * from 民族代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xNation.Items.Add(myDataReader民族);myDataReader.Close();comboBoxNation.SelectedIndex=0;/初始化comboBoxPlace(籍贯)myCommand.CommandText=select * from 籍贯代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xPlace.Items.Add(myDataReader籍贯);myDataReader.Close();comboBoxPlace.SelectedIndex=0;/初始化comboBoxStudyState(学习状况)comboBoxStudyState.Items.Add(在读);comboBoxStudyState.Items.Add(休学);comboBoxStudyState.Items.Add(已毕业);comboBoxStudyState.SelectedIndex=0;private void buttonBrowse_Click(object sender, System.EventArgs e)OpenFileDialog ofd=new OpenFileDialog();ofd.Filter=图像文件(*.bmp)|*.bmp;DialogResult dlr=ofd.ShowDialog();if(dlr=DialogResult.OK)Image image1=Image.FromFile(ofd.FileName); textBoxPhotoPath.Text=ofd.FileName;pictureBox1.Image=image1;private void buttonAfresh_Click(object sender, System.EventArgs e)/清空文本框,置光标于“学号”文本框内this.textBoxNumber.Text=;this.textBoxName.Text=;this.textBoxPhotoPath.Text=;this.pictureBox1.Image=null;this.textBoxNumber.Focus();private void buttonExit_Click(object sender, System.EventArgs e)this.Close();指导练习课后小记 授课教师 常 州 轻 工 职 业 技 术 学 院 可视化程序设计 课 程 授 课 教 案 No 32 授 课 日 期2012/4/27授 课 班 级课 题实验八:多窗格数据处理设计授 课 类 型实验课课 时 数2教 学目 的掌握分页处理窗体程序的编写重 点难 点树型控件、列表视图控件等的综合使用。教 具挂 图教学过程及时间分配主 要 教 学 内 容教学方法的运用10分10分实验内容:编程分页显示学生管理数据库中的数据,通过命令按钮在各页间切换,并可对选定的记录进行删除操作。操作步骤:1 设计窗体2 设置控件和窗体的属性3 主要代码讲解指导练习40分private void Form1_Load(object sender, System.EventArgs e)/初始化comboBoxClass(班级)string connectionString=Server=.;Database=XSGL;user id=sa; pwd=;SqlConnection myConnection=new SqlConnection(connectionString);SqlCommand myCommand=myConnection.CreateCommand();myCommand.CommandText=select * from 班级信息表;myConnection.Open();SqlDataReader my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xClass.Items.Add(myDataReader班级名称);myDataReader.Close();comboBoxClass.SelectedIndex=0;/初始化日期拾取器DateTime now=DateTime.Now;int year=now.Year-19;DateTime dt=new DateTime(year,now.Month,now.Day); dateTimePicker1.Value=dt;/初始化comboBoxFace(政治面貌)myCommand.CommandText=select * from 政治面貌代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xFace.Items.Add(myDataReader政治面貌);myDataReader.Close();comboBoxFace.SelectedIndex=0;/初始化comboBoxNation(民族)myCommand.CommandText=select * from 民族代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xNation.Items.Add(myDataReader民族);myDataReader.Close();comboBoxNation.SelectedIndex=0;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xPlace.Items.Add(myDataReader籍贯);myDataReader.Close();comboBoxPlace.SelectedIndex=0;/初始化comboBoxStudyState(学习状况)comboBoxStudyState.Items.Add(在读);comboBoxStudyState.Items.Add(休学);comboBoxStudyState.Items.Add(已毕业);comboBoxStudyState.SelectedIndex=0;30/初始化comboBoxPlace(籍贯)myCommand.CommandText=select * from 籍贯代码表;myDataReader=myCommand.ExecuteReader();while( myDataReader.Read()comboBoxPlace.Items.Add(myDataReader籍贯);myDataReader.Close();comboBoxPlace.SelectedIndex=0;/初始化comboBoxStudyState(学习状况)comboBoxStudyState.Items.Add(在读);comboBoxStudyState.Items.Add(休学);comboBoxStudyState.Items.Add(已毕业);comboBoxStudyState.SelectedIndex=0;private void buttonBrowse_Click(object sender, System.EventArgs e)OpenFileDialog
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 打架伤人和解协议书范本
- 茶园租赁合同(含茶叶加工销售)
- 文化创意园区场地改造与运营管理合同
- 摄影拍摄场合记人员聘用合同协议
- 监控业务转让协议书范本
- 厕所清洁服务合同范本(含夜间保洁)
- 体育产业代理记账与赛事运营财务管理协议
- 产权车库购置及车位共享合同
- 声屏障降噪效果测试专题报告
- 【课件】大气压强教学课件+2024-2025学年人教版物理八年级下学期+
- 《光伏电站运行与维护》课件-项目五 光伏电站常见故障处理
- 使用错误评估报告(可用性工程)模版
- 委托办事合同范例
- 高中生物必修知识点总结(人教版复习提纲)高考基础
- 江西省抚州市2023-2024学年高二下学期期末考试数学
- 汽车以租代购合同
- 高中英语新课程标准解读课件
- 道路、公共广场清扫保洁作业服务投标方案(技术方案)
- DB34-T 4754-2024 人力资源服务产业园运营规范
- 建设项目全过程工程咨询服务投标方案
- GB/T 41782.3-2024物联网系统互操作性第3部分:语义互操作性
评论
0/150
提交评论